About University

About Muenster University of Applied Sciences, Germany

1. Programs and Faculties: The university offers a diverse selection of undergraduate and postgraduate programs across multiple faculties, including engineering, business, design, social sciences, health, and more. Each faculty focuses on practical skills and application-oriented learning to prepare students for the job market.

2. Research and Innovation: Muenster University of Applied Sciences actively engages in research and development projects, often in collaboration with industry partners. This fosters innovation and contributes to solving real-world problems.

3. Internationalization: The university encourages internationalization and provides opportunities for students to participate in exchange programs and study abroad experiences. This helps create a multicultural learning environment and broadens students' perspectives.

4. Campus and Facilities: The university campus is equipped with modern facilities, including state-of-the-art laboratories, libraries, computer centers, sports facilities, and student services. These amenities contribute to a conducive learning environment for students.

5. Language of Instruction: Most degree programs at the Muenster University of Applied Sciences are taught in German. However, some programs may have English-taught courses or international programs specifically designed for international students.

6. Application and Admission: Prospective students must fulfill specific admission requirements for the program they wish to apply to. These requirements may include language proficiency tests and educational qualifications. The application process typically involves submitting required documents and may vary depending on the program and the student's country of origin.

Intake And Eligibility of Muenster University of Applied Sciences, Germany

Intake: Muenster University of Applied Sciences typically follows a semester system with two main intakes per year for most programs:

  1. Winter Semester: The winter semester usually begins in October.

  2. Summer Semester: The summer semester typically starts in April.

Eligibility: Eligibility criteria for admission to Muenster University of Applied Sciences can differ depending on the specific program. However, some common requirements for international students may include:

For Bachelor's Programs:

  1. A valid secondary school leaving certificate or equivalent qualification.

  2. Proof of German language proficiency. Many programs are taught in German, so proficiency in the language is often required. Some programs may offer English-taught courses for international students.

For Master's Programs:

  1. A recognized bachelor's degree or equivalent in a related field.

  2. Proof of German or English language proficiency, depending on the language of instruction for the chosen program.

Students Life at Muenster University of Applied Sciences, Germany

1. Academic Environment: Muenster University of Applied Sciences provides a supportive and conducive academic environment. Students have access to modern facilities, well-equipped laboratories, libraries, and computer centers to enhance their learning experience. The university emphasizes practical-oriented education, promoting hands-on learning and industry collaboration.

2. Student Organizations and Clubs: There are various student organizations and clubs at the university catering to different interests and hobbies. Joining these groups provides opportunities for students to engage with like-minded peers, participate in events, and develop leadership skills.

3. Cultural and Sports Activities: The university hosts a range of cultural events, sports tournaments, and recreational activities throughout the year. These events foster a sense of community and provide students with opportunities to socialize, unwind, and explore their interests beyond academics.

4. International Community: Muenster University of Applied Sciences attracts a diverse community of international students. This diversity enriches the cultural exchange on campus and provides an opportunity for students to learn about different cultures and perspectives.

5. Support Services: The university offers various support services to assist students during their academic journey. These services may include counseling, academic advising, career services, and support for international students.

6. Student Housing: Muenster University of Applied Sciences provides various accommodation options for students, both on-campus and off-campus. Living in student dormitories or shared apartments can foster a sense of community and facilitate friendships among students.

7. City of Muenster: Muenster is a vibrant city with a rich history, offering a wide range of cultural events, recreational activities, and a lively nightlife. Students can explore the city's museums, theaters, parks, cafes, and restaurants, making their time outside of university enjoyable and fulfilling.


Placements in Muenster University of Applied Sciences, Germany

1. Career Services: The university typically offers career services and support to help students prepare for the job market. This includes assistance with job search strategies, resume writing, interview preparation, and networking opportunities.

2. Industry Partnerships: Muenster University of Applied Sciences collaborates closely with various companies, organizations, and industries. This relationship can lead to internship opportunities, cooperative education experiences, and potential job offers for students.

3. Job Fairs and Events: The university may organize job fairs, career events, and company presentations, providing students with opportunities to interact with potential employers and learn about job openings.

4. Alumni Network: The university's alumni network can also play a significant role in helping graduates find employment opportunities. Alumni may offer mentorship, referrals, and insights into various industries.

5. Practical Training: Many programs at Muenster University of Applied Sciences include mandatory or optional practical training components. This hands-on experience can enhance students' employability and industry readiness.

6. Strong Reputation: The university's reputation within certain industries can also positively impact the placement prospects of its graduates.
